Output 62f154a117562668fd13bb98f5c6663595e039a15ba403bd8a45269a03b10432:0

value
656705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db0b284cd72f5de35739cce81ccd3471499c4914 OP_EQUALVERIFY OP_CHECKSIG
address
1LyCMF3enZ8KZXRbqtCvgvAMWziCoJnnEy
transaction
62f154a117562668fd13bb98f5c6663595e039a15ba403bd8a45269a03b10432
spent
true